| name: |
Differential host-dependent expression of alpha-galactosyl epitopes on viral glycoproteins: a study of eastern equine encephalitis virus as a model.
|
| description: |
The epitope is abundantly expressed on cells of non-primate mammals, prosimians and New World monkeys, but not Old World monkeys, apes and humans.
Affinity purified epitope specific antibodies recognized bovine thyroglobulin and the binding was inhabited with 3T3 derived EEE virus or bovine thyroglobulin.
